基于RateLimiter拦截器实现简单的限流

41 阅读1分钟

老项目做抢购活动,但是没有网关等限流措施,使用google的 guava包下的RateLimiter,实现Aspect,使用注解的方式对指定的请求做限流控制,使用ScheduleExecutor延时任务针对接口的限流请求做调整

ratelimiter.png